Correction, I never said anything about an IAT or a MAP mod. It is a rail pressure mod by using the sensor signal back to the ECU. Read my post again. I meant no offense to you about being a weekend project. Some weekend projects can look good. I have never seen your module before so I never commented on the design or quality. I was simply stating the technology used. It is really no different than an EZ in increasing rail pressure other than the EZ also does MAP so it can do lookup tables versus boost and rail pressure but that's also why it costs quite a bit more. well i had it sittin here figured i'd try it out. put it in by it-self ran it a little to see if it would throw any codes,nothing, so i put my smarty jr back in with it it has good throtle response it's real touchy which the smarty really isnt by itself. I dogged it a good little bit and no problems only thing is in the highest setting i believe it's 5 once you let off the pedal it has a funny idle feeling to it.But only in 5. Other than that it seems like a pretty descent chip..I mean it's not the edge ez but for the money it seems alright.
